Rising star Maya Lane has announced her debut headline show at The Grace, London for Wednesday 3rdSeptember. Tickets for the show are on sale now, available here.

The news adds to a breakthrough year for the singer-songwriter, who performed at Europe’s biggest Country music festival Country 2 Country at The O2 in March, and is set to perform at Noah Kahan’s British Summertime Hyde Park show, as well as supporting country stars Margo Price and Breland in the UK. Achieving all of this in between her self-promoted living room tours, where she travels around the UK playing in fan’s living rooms, Maya was also recently selected out of thousands of applicants as one of American Express’s Unsigned competition winners. 

Currently writing and recording with the likes of Wayne Hector (Tate Mcrae, Birdy), Rob Milton (Holly Humberstone, The 1975), Jonathan Quarmby (Tom Walker, Lewis Capaldi) and Jonny Lattimer (Ellie Goulding, Anne Marie), Maya Lane’s next chapter is set to be her most exciting yet.
A singer-songwriter from London, Maya is emotionally mature beyond her years and a natural storyteller. Her Pop Country/Folk style draws influences from the likes of Fleetwood MacKacey MusgravesHAIM and Joni Mitchell.

In her short career Maya has accumulated over 2.5 million streams and has picked up editorial playlists on Spotify including Chilled Pop Hits, Noteable, Fresh Finds Folk and Fresh Finds UK and IE (front cover) and on Apple Music including New In PopChill PopNew in CountryNew in AmericanaNew Music Daily, UK & Irish Country and Today’s Country. Her singles have been played 10 times by Mollie King on Radio 1’s Future Pop with Mollie saying “Another artist here demonstrating how much Country music is coming through in Pop right now. I absolutely love it.” Maya has received support from blogs and national newspapers such as Wonderland, Clash, Notion,The Line of Best FitThe IndependentHollerThe Daily Star and The Sunday Mirror.
